I have brought a Digital boost gauge went to fit it today on my S2 and opened the instructions to find that it looks like its been written by a far eastern guy with no knowledge at all on anything to do with cars....
Anyway on the sender unit it a t-piece which obviously fits into a hose that has to be cut. The instructions say to fit this onto the 'manifold vavuum hose on car' any ideas which hose this is sposed to be and where its located. Thanks, Joe

Top of inlet manifold, best fitted to left hand hose, or ideally tapp one into the inlet where the 2 are already at the top, loads of hassle tho so jus use the vaccum take off on the left, right hand is for ECU, can also use this one np, BUT can fuck up the ecu's signal if any leaks at all.....
